Both drivers and passengers in the vehicles were taken to the hospital. On June 27, crash investigators were notified that the male passenger who was injured in the Edge died as a result of injuries sustained during the crash. All other involved parties are expected to survive. Investigators determined that speed, alcohol, and drugs were not factors for the driver. At the time of the collision, the driver of the Edge, identified as Doris Ann Grosskopf, was charged. The investigation continues.
Doris Ann Grosskopf, 82, of the 12100 block of Clipper Drive in Woodbridge, is charged with failure to follow a traffic signal. She is due in court on August 26, 2024, and was released on a court summons.

June 27 is National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der Screening Day. The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) offers an online screening tool for those who may be experiencing symptoms.
The VA website says it is the world’s leading research and educational center of excellence on PTSD and traumatic stress, and explains “PTSD is a mental health problem that some people develop after experiencing or witnessing a life-threatening or traumatic event.”
On Tuesday, June 25, at 10:40 p.m., officers responded to Tackett’s Mill Shopping Mall in the 2200 block of Old Bridge Road in Lake Ridge. The response was to investigate a shots fired call.
The investigation revealed that two victims, a 22-year-old male and a 21-year-old female, were in the parking lot when a black SUV drove by and fired BB or other pellet-type rounds from the vehicle, striking both victims. No injuries were reported. No additional injuries or property damage were reported.
